I have previously mentioned that I have initially created the actual PAGE for Satin and Brass - but if you have taken a gander recently you may have realized that it has seen little love since then.

So my 'thing' was to show the FB page some love.

I have posted a few 'sneak' peeks of my projects and done a couple social type posts. I need to do more but making it 'active' without having much to post as far as saleable objects to post seemed a worthwhile project.


Additionally, I made myself completely familiar with the set-up of the vendor pages, downloaded the vendor pages tracking application, and I did an experimental 'boost' of a post.

Boosting is paying a small incremental amount and having FB send your post onto the walls of people who you are not yet specifically friends with yet. I wasn't sure why I would be doing this so soon in the lifecycle of my page but I figure it was an experiment into the facets of paid advertising.

My foray into the unknown wasn't completely unsuccessful.

I got responses and likes from a few strangers and a comment from someone all the way in Texas. While she wasn't super excited that she could not attend the Gypsy Market - it was exciting to see that I could spread that far with a mere $5 in advertising.

I will continue to put a few more posts up onto this site and will most likely encourage my counterparts to also put up a few things - but I don't see up concentrating on making this a fount of pictures and content for our business unless S&B is highly successful at Gypsy (AND we decide to continue forth in its pursuit). I just think making projects and concentrating on my side hustle might be more useful until those things can be proven.
